Betting Strategies
Understanding how to place your bets effectively is an integral part of maximizing your gambling experience. Here are some strategies that may assist you in navigating the often unpredictable waters of slot games:
Common Betting Systems
- Flat Betting: In this method, players stake the same amount each time. It’s simple and helps to manage your bankroll systematically.
- Martingale System: This method is more aggressive, where players double their bet after every loss. The idea here is to recover losses with a single win, but it can deplete your funds faster than anticipated.
- D'Alembert System: Mirroring the Martingale approach but less risky, this system suggests increasing your bet by one unit after a loss and decreasing it by one after a win.
Advanced Betting Techniques
For the more seasoned gamblers, advanced techniques can provide that added edge.
- Variance Tracking: Understanding the volatility of a slot game allows players to gauge how often and how significantly they can expect to win. Some games offer small, frequent payouts while others deliver fewer large ones.
- Progressive Betting: This strategy involves gradually increasing your bets after wins. It's a way to leverage a winning streak without giving too much back on a loss.
- Time Management: One often overlooked aspect is managing your time spent at the slots. Setting a timer can encourage disciplined play, preventing emotional decisions that might lead to excessive losses.
There’s no surefire way to guarantee winnings, but employing these strategies offers a structured approach to engaging with slot games.

Return to Player (RTP) Rates
RTP rates provide valuable insight into a slot's profitability. Generally expressed as a percentage, the RTP indicates the expected return a player can anticipate over time. For example, a slot with an RTP of 96% theoretically returns $96 for every $100 wagered. This number doesn't guarantee wins but offers a statistical benchmark players can rely on. Higher RTPs are viewed as more attractive, drawing in players who are interested in maximizing their chances of a favorable outcome.
Volatility and Variance
Volatility, also referred to as variance, evaluates the risk involved in playing a particular slot. High-volatility slots might deliver larger wins, but they do so less frequently, leading to stretches of dry spells. On the flip side, low-volatility slots tend to yield wins more regularly but often of smaller amounts. Identifying the volatility of a game is essential because it aligns with the player's risk appetite. If one prefers to keep the game lively with frequent wins, they might lean toward low-volatility options.

Bonus Rounds
Bonus rounds add layers of excitement to the slot experience. Typically triggered by specific symbols, these rounds can offer free spins, additional multipliers, or unique mini-games. What makes them appealing is their ability to amplify wins without additional bets, making them a hot topic among players. The uniqueness of bonus rounds varies—from narrative-driven experiences to simple pick-and-win formats. The thrill they introduce is a key part of what makes certain slots stand out.
Free Spins
Free spins are another beloved feature, granting players chances to spin without dipping into their balance. These spins are often tied to specific conditions, such as landing scatter symbols during gameplay. What makes free spins particularly advantageous is their ability to generate winnings without increasing the financial risk. However, players must pay attention to the terms associated with these spins, such as wagering requirements, which might impact their cash-out potential.
Progressive Jackpots
Progressive jackpots are a defining feature of many modern slots, creating an irresistible allure for gamblers. Unlike standard jackpot slots, which offer a fixed amount, progressive jackpots grow with each player's wager until someone hits the big win. This not only heightens the excitement but also makes players feel they are in the race for potentially life-altering sums. The catch, of course, is that the likelihood of hitting that jackpot is slim. For most, the thrill lies in the chase and the dream of obtaining a life-changing payout, making progressive jackpots a hallmark of the best slots to seek out.

Random Number Generators
At the heart of every digital slot machine is a system known as the Random Number Generator (RNG). This software program is designed to ensure that every spin of the reels is entirely random and independent of previous spins. The RNG generates thousands of numbers per second, even when the machine is not in play. This means that the outcome of a spin is determined in a blink, giving each player an equal chance of winning. The importance of RNG cannot be overstated; it guarantees fairness and transparency, which are crucial for maintaining player trust.
Furthermore, many jurisdictions require that RNGs are regularly tested by third-party agencies to verify their randomness. This testing ensures compliance with regulatory standards, thereby reinforcing the integrity of online casinos. Thus, the utilization of RNG technology not only assures players of a fair gaming process but also serves as a foundation for responsible gambling practices.

Cognitive Bias in Game Choices
Cognitive biases can have a profound impact on decision-making in the realm of gambling, particularly with slot machines. Players might not always make the most rational choices; instead, their selections can be influenced by several cognitive pitfalls. For example, the Gambler’s Fallacy often leads players to believe that past outcomes will influence future results, which is fundamentally a misinterpretation of probability. This bias can cause players to favor slots they feel are "due" for a payout, leading them away from more advantageous choices.
Other biases, such as aversion to loss, can also steer decision-making. Many players might stick to familiar games that have provided wins in the past, ignoring other potentially profitable options. Setting a Budget
One key principle in gambling is the necessity of setting a budget. Treating gambling as a form of entertainment rather than a method to make money is vital. Establishing a budget ensures that players know their limits, creating a safeguard against overspending.
- Start Small: Begin with a modest budget to get a feel for the games. As you grow more comfortable, you can adjust this amount.
- Use Cash Only: When you play, opt for cash transactions. This prevents you from overspending via credit cards or online transfers.
- Stick to Your Limit: Setting a strict limit on losses can help avoid the pitfall of chasing losses, a common error that can lead to financial strain.
- Playing Time: Determine a specific amount of time for your gaming sessions. This can prevent burnout and impulsive decisions to wager larger sums.
Setting a budget isn’t just about numbers; it’s also tied to emotional control. It’s about having a clear mind while playing, ensuring that the thrill does not turn into despair due to impulsive financial decisions.
Choosing the Right Games
With countless options available, selecting the right slot games can make or break the enjoyment of your experience. The choice should align not only with personal preferences but also with strategic considerations. Here are some points to help you pick wisely:
- Understand Game Variance: Different games have different volatility levels. Low variance slots tend to pay out smaller amounts more frequently, while high variance slots offer larger payouts less often. Align your choice with your budget and risk tolerance.
- Look for Bonus Features: Identify games that offer enticing bonuses, free spins, or jackpots. These features can enhance your chances of indulging in more extended gameplay without necessarily increasing your spend.
- Play Demo Versions: Before committing to real money, take advantage of free demo versions of games. This gives you an opportunity to understand gameplay and features without financial risk.
- Read Reviews: Engaging with online communities such as reddit.com can provide real-life insights into game performance and player experience.
Choosing the right games involves research and introspection. Players need to determine what kind of experience they are seeking while keeping in mind responsible gambling practices.
